From the Aegean coast into the heartland of Turkey, this active tour shows both the harshness and beauty of the landscape and also provides adventurists with all the excitement nature can throw at them; from rafting the Dalaman River to hiking the Saklikent Gorge and the famous Lycian Way.

Day 1: arrival day, Fethiye (dinner included).

Depending on your arrival point, you will be transferred from Dalaman Airport or Fethiye bus station to your Hotel. After checking in to the hotel, the rest of the day is free to explore Fethiye. Overnight in hotel in Oludeniz or Fethiye.


Day 2: Rafting Dalaman (breakfast and dinner included).

An opportunity to experience real adventure in unspoilt mountain scenery. We raft through narrow limestone gorges surrounded by magnificent pine forests and tackle exhilarating white water. Bathe in natural Jacuzzis, swim in shallow pools, jump off rocks and drink from crystal clear streams. Overnight in Oludeniz or Fethiye.


Day 3: Saklikent Gorge (breakfast and dinner included).

09:00 am Drive to Tlos & walk in Saklikent Gorge, Europe’s second largest at 20km long. Sculpted walls soar high above while fresh mountain water runs through the bottom of the gorge – a walkway of 4km runs through the gorge. There is a chance to embark on an adventure by joining the canyoning activities such as river-rafting or exploring the gorge before returning to Fethiye. Overnight.


Day 4: Kas (breakfast and dinner included).

09:00am We depart for Butterfly Valley by boat. The Butterfly Valley near Fethiye is a hidden gem of Turkey's Turquoise Coast. Deep, steep and accessible only by boat or via the Lycian Way walking trail, it is a protected site because millions of butterflies - over 30 daytime species including the Jersey Tiger Moth and 40 nocturnal species. After Butterfly Valley Tour then drive to Kas for the night. Overnight in Kas.


Day 5: Kas (breakfast and dinner included).

Explore Kas, a pretty coastal town with small harbour, some souvenir shops and pleasant cafe bars and a small ancient amphitheatre on the outskirts of town. There are water sports available in the area, like canoeing, jet skiing, diving and paragliding. Overnight in Kas.


Day 6: Demre (breakfast and dinner included).

Check out of hotel and begin the day with a walk along the Lycian Way to the sunken city of Aperlae. This island is partially submerged under the water because of earthquakes which occurred throughout history; it is also known as the "Sunken City”. Following this the tour moves on to Kekova island, accessible by boat from Kas and offering a fun way to combine an exploration of ancient Lycian ruins with swimming in turquoise waters and a barbecue on the beach. Drive to Finike and overnight.


Day 7: Olympos (breakfast and dinner included).

Leave Finike and walk along the Lycian Way to Olympos & Chimaera - the unquenchable flame. A series of eternal flames flicker along the rocky slopes above the ancient city of Olympos; caused by the combustion of a predominantly methane gas mixture seeping out of the earth. Overnight in Olympos at the Tree Houses & Bungalows.


Day 8: Olympos (breakfast and dinner included).

Rest day in Olympos. Enjoy the sunshine and take in the stunning views, relax on the beach or explore the area and unspoilt scenery. Overnight in Olympos at Tree Houses & Bungalows.


Day 9: Termessos and Duden Waterfall (breakfast and dinner included).

After breakfast depart for Termessos. The ruins of the city of Termessos are perched on a 1050m high plateau on the west face of the Gulluk Mountain (Solymos) found in Mt. Gulluk National Park, northwest of Antalya. A wild and splendid landscape surrounds the monumental traces of this city which dates back more than 2000 years. This is followed by a visit to Duden Waterfalls before leaving for Antalya for overnight.


Day 10: Antalya and Egirdir (breakfast and dinner included).

After breakfast depart for Egirdir on the southern tip of the most beautiful Pisidian lakes. Egirdir is a fine place to stop in the midst of your journey for two days of quiet rest and contemplation. Overnight in Egirdir.


Day 11.: Free day in Egirdir (breakfast and dinner included).

Explore Egirdir which shows another side of Turkey all together. Swimming, boating and hiking can fill a few days around the beautiful natural lake that lies at Egirdir. There are famous fish to be caught here that seem to have no bones; this fish is extremely delicious and shouldn’t be missed in a traditional meal washed down with the famous Turkish drink, Raki. There are a number of small farms located in this area where you can see the workers using traditional methods of farming. You will be welcomed by all people in this region. Overnight in Egirdir.


Day 12: Egirdir, Konya and Cappadocia (breakfast and dinner included).

This morning we drive to Konya and see the imposing green-tiled Mausoleum of Mevlana & museum; the mystic founder of the Sufi sect (Whirling Dervishes). After Konya we depart for Cappadocia in central Turkey. The strange but beautiful formation of Cappadocia occurred millions of years ago when volcanoes were active in the region. It is estimated that there are more than 600 rock-cut churches in Cappadocia; the walls are covered with beautiful frescoes, some of which are still clearly visible today. The underground cities in Cappadocia are unique too; they were used by the local people to hide from invading armies from the east. There are also loads of activities available in Cappadocia including hot-air ballooning, horse and camel riding and trekking. Overnight in Cappadocia.


Day 13: Cappadocia safari tour by 4x4 (breakfast and dinner included).

The full day Cappadocian Jeep Safari begins in the deep-set valley town of Urgup and moves on to the Uzengi River. The drive will take you through scenery that includes pigeon houses, the grape growing district and the nearby wineries of Ortahisar. The 4x4 tour will then take passengers off the beaten track with a visit to the picturesque caves of the Red Valley. The 4x4 safari provides the perfect opportunity to soak up the natural beauty of the Cappadocian scenery. Overnight in Cappadocia.


Day 14: Cappadocia (breakfast and dinner included).

We'll pick you up in your hotel and depart at 09:00 to drive to Ihlara Valley. There, we'll walk nearly 4 km and visit the frescoed churches. A lunch stop is made in Ihlara Valley by the banks of the Melendiz River, which flows through the valley. After lunch we'll visit Selime Cathedral and return back to Derinkuyu Underground City, one of the region’s underground cities, once inhabited by thousands of people and having a cool and pleasant temperature to explore. On the way, we'll visit the Nar Crater Lake before driving on to Pigeon Valley to see the pigeon houses which were made to collect guano. Overnight in Cappadocia.


Day 15: Cappadocia, end of the tour (breakfast included).

After breakfast check out from the hotel and transfer to Kayseri Airport where the tour ends.
